Output 0380f4cc959da035db2bd4e6459c0f43b5e1b8b95fb9cbfe7132c3390780d4a2:1

value
7425588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88e989fda42135c74060684ad8a3a8a465e5da4f OP_EQUAL
address
3EAwbD4Q8CeakLdYReyHrmJzMxRKYVoRyc
transaction
0380f4cc959da035db2bd4e6459c0f43b5e1b8b95fb9cbfe7132c3390780d4a2
confirmations
453021
spent
true